Position Summary

Assists the Director of MDS in the development, completion and transmission of the resident assessment in accordance with the state requirements and policies and goals of the facility.

Participates in development and completion of preliminary and comprehensive resident assessment (MDS) and Care Plan in accordance with current rules, regulations, and guidelines, including the implementation of CAAs and Triggers and Plan of Care. Ensures that care plan includes measurable objectives and timetables to meet resident's medical, nursing, mental and psychosocial needs, that appropriate health professionals are involved in assessment, and that schedule of activities is developed as required. K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, ABILITIES & QUALIFICATIONS 1-3 years' experience providing direct care to multiple patients/residents, one years' previous MDS experience in Skilled Nursing environment preferred Nursing degree from accredited college or graduation from approved RN program Must possess current, unencumbered license to practice as an RN in California. Current valid CPR certification Knowledge of clinical standards of practice, regulations and reimbursement governing long term care and Medicare participation Commitment to the company mission to consistently deliver high quality, person-centered care with dignity, respect, compassion and integrity, and to enrich every life we touch.
